When it comes to ticketing, Ilkeston keeps things simple—you won't find a traditional ticket office here. But don't worry, as ticket machines are available for collecting tickets bought online. Accessibility is well-thought-out with step-free access throughout, ensuring a comfortable experience for everyone. However, if you rely on assistance from station staff, please be aware that staff help isn't available at Ilkeston. Should you need help, assistance can be pre-booked through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ring your journey plans don't hit any bumps.
For onward travel from Ilkeston, it's a breeze to catch a bus or hop into a taxi. If needs be, a rail replacement service operates on Coronation Road. If taxis are more your speed, call Avenger Taxi at 0115 932 1642 or Near-N-Far at 0115 930 0300. Though the station doesn't offer cycling hire facilities, there are 18 bicycle stands should you wish to store your bike while you travel.

Newton St Cyres station is an unstaffed station with minimal facilities. There is no ticket office or ticket machine, so it's advisable to purchase your tickets in advance online. While the station offers an induction loop for hearing-impaired passengers, those needing mobility assistance should be aware that step-free access is limited. Despite being designated a B2 category for step-free access, reaching the station platform involves navigating a steep approach road. CCTV is present, though luggage storage and waiting rooms are absent, ensuring that those passing through do so with a light load.
Public transport connections from the station are straightforward yet require some planning. You'll find bus services accessible from the nearby A377, replacing rail services when needed. For more precise information on the bus routes and schedules, you can view the transportation map online. Unfortunately, there are no provisions for cycling facilities, taxi ranks, or car hire, so it’s best to arrange these services ahead of your arrival.
